## Deployment

ReceiptWren, our donation-receipt mailer, deploys from the `stable` branch via the Quillgate pipeline. Before promoting a build, confirm the template bundle version matches what the Harbrook finance team signed off on, since receipts are legally sensitive. Run the dry-run mailer against the sandbox donor list and inspect at least three rendered PDFs. Rollbacks must restore both the binary and the template bundle together; mismatched pairs produce blank totals. The environment expects the following configuration values at startup.

settings of tawif-tafog:
[oliox]
port = 7000
team = pelius
host = oliox.plorvaforge.corp
region = upper-2
access_code = ac_48b9f0
timeout_ms = 3000

**Action Item 7: Enable log sampling on Pigeonrelay**

Pigeonrelay logged every heartbeat at INFO during the incident, which blew past our ingestion quota and meant the actually useful errors got dropped. Not great when you're debugging at 3 a.m. We're adding adaptive sampling: keep all WARN and above, sample INFO at 1%, bump the rate automatically when error volume spikes. Owner: the Relays squad, due end of sprint. Rollout steps and the kill switch are documented on the runbook page.

runbook for tafof-yawif: https://confluence.tolvaqsys.internal/display/display/browse/pages/7be3

## Environment Variables — Driver Assignment Heuristic

The Routewren dispatcher weights driver proximity, shift fatigue, and vehicle class when assigning pickups. Weights are tunable via `RW_HEURISTIC_PROFILE`, and staging must mirror production to keep A/B comparisons valid. The heuristic service authenticates to the assignment queue with a token defined on the following line.

sealed setting: LEDGER_TOKEN13=5d842615a26d7

The Harrowgate scheduler is supposed to pre-create next month's partition on the 25th, but the job silently skipped October, so inserts after midnight on the 1st landed in the default partition and slowed queries. Workaround: run the partition-maintenance task manually and migrate stray rows. For new folks: this table is partitioned by event month, not ingestion time, which surprises everyone once. The build where the scheduler regression shipped is identified by the token below.

pipeline stamp: htk31_f769b577b3028a4e9958e5bb8d1259a